Luis Garcia powers Nationals past Mariners with key homer

Luis Garcia went 1-for-4 with a home run and three RBI in the Nationals' 6-1 victory over the Mariners.

Fantasy Impact

His performance was highlighted by a crucial home run that helped extend the Nationals' lead. With this game, Garcia's season totals have improved to a .279 batting average with five homers and 26 RBI. His consistent ability to drive in runs, coupled with a decent batting average, makes him a valuable asset in most fantasy formats. However, his moderate strikeout rate and low walk rate suggest a need for caution, as these could limit his on-base opportunities. Garcia's power numbers are respectable for a second baseman, and if he can maintain or improve his consistency at the plate, he should remain a solid option in fantasy lineups.

Luis Garcia Powers Nationals to Easy Victory Over Twins

Luis Garcia went 2-for-4 with a home run and three RBI in the Nationals' 12-3 rout of the Twins.

Fantasy Impact

His performance included a key home run that contributed significantly to the team's offensive explosion. Garcia's season has been solid, maintaining a .281 batting average with consistent power and run production. His ability to drive in runs, evidenced by his 23 RBI in 39 games, makes him a valuable asset in fantasy lineups, especially in leagues that value RBI and home runs.

Luis Garcia (wrist) not expected to miss much time

Luis Garcia is not expected to miss much time after jamming his wrist Sunday.

Fantasy Impact

Garcia suffered the injury while sliding into second base and was removed in the eighth inning Sunday. With the Nationals off yesterday, Garcia could be given Tuesday off to ensure he does not have any setbacks.

Luis Garcia powers Nationals past Blue Jays

Luis Garcia went 1-for-1 with a home run, three RBI, and two runs scored in the Nationals' 9-3 victory over the Blue Jays.

Fantasy Impact

Garcia's performance, highlighted by a critical home run, significantly contributed to the team's win. This season, Garcia has maintained a solid .300 batting average and his power display, although infrequent with just two homers, shows potential for more. His ability to drive in runs, now totaling 14 RBI, coupled with a decent speed on bases, suggests he could be a valuable all-around asset in fantasy lineups. Fantasy managers should consider his consistent contact and emerging power, especially in leagues that value middle infielders who contribute across multiple categories.
